Beadandók:
A kurzus sikeres teljesítéséhez mindegyik beadandót sikeresen meg kell csinálni.
- Git alapok beadandó: itt (lejárt).
- Root beadandó
A hivatalos honlapról töltsétek le a root-ot, majd Build-eljétek fel, ehhez itt találtok segítséget. A feladat készítsetek egy egyszerű macro-t, ami a következőket tudja:
- Ábrázoljatok rajta két tetszőleges egyszerű adatsort
- Az ábrázolásnál fontos, hogy legyenek tengelyfeliratok, ábrafelirat, legend, változtassátok meg a adatsorok színét, markerét, errorbar-okat.
- Illeszétek meg a két különböző adatsort és ábrázoljátok egy következő ábrán az illesztéseket
- Az így kapott két hisztogramot mentsétek el .root fileként és küldjétek el emailben
- Honlapszerkesztés beadandó:
- Csináld végig a tutorialokat az oldalon, ez kelleni fog a továbbiakhoz.
- Válassz ki egy tetszőleges laborgyakorlatot, aminek a honlapját fogod megtervezni (remélhetőleg olyat, amiben programoztatok és notebookot is használtatok).
- A honlap szóljon az egész labor tartalmáról. Legyen egy általános leírása, legyen hozzá felhasznált irodalom, legyen beszúrva kép akár az egyik labor helyszínéről (vagy az egyetemről), valamint követelmények, saját megjegyzés, egyéb extrák plusz pont. Ezekhez a bekezdésekhez elég pár mondatot írni, hogy érthető legyen külsős, nem fizikus ember számára is.
- Hogy vissza tudjak lépni, legyenek hivatkozások az előző oldalakra is, e.g., Home page >> Tanulmányok >> Saját labor (értelemszerűen hivatkozás mindegyik).
- Legyenek felsorolva a laboralkalmak jegyzőkönyvei (letölthető formában (hint: download)), meg a hozzájuk tartozó jegyzet például (nem kell mindegyik, de néhanyat illik).
- Az egész oldalnak legyen egy külön .css fájlja, mely csak erre az oldalra vonatkozik, és (könyörögve kérlek) formázzátok meg szépre; középre zárás, lebegjenek egymás mellett, színek jól láthatóak legyenek, margót és paddinget bátran használjunk, betűtípus nem comic sans, stb.
- Az egyik tetszőlegesen választott órához készült jegyzőkönyvből csináljatok python prezentációt, nézzen úgy ki, mintha tényleg előadnátok (ha nincs ilyen, csináljatok egyet kézzel):
- Használjatok különböző cellatípusokat (slide, fragment, stb.), valamint kód és markdownt szintén.
- Legyenek benne színes-szagos ábrák, jól látható módon.
- Legyen benne vázlatos magyarázat a mérésről.
- Markdown cella díszítése plusz pont.
- Ne felejtsd el használni a verziókövetést, valamint a google-t! Sok időt meg tudsz spórolni magadnak.
- Ha végeztél, a szokásos git parancsokkal (add, commit, push) mentsd el az egészet a githubon, hogy én is el tudjam érni.
- Ha elakadsz, nyugodtan írj egy emailt nekem (Furu, elérhetőségek a honlapon).
Órák:
- 1. óra (feb. 12.): Bevezetés a verziókövetésbe: git alapok - elmélet [Ricsi]
- 2. óra (feb. 19.): Bevezetés a verziókövetésbe: git alapok - gyakorlat [Furu, Ricsi jegyzetei alapján]
- Sematikus jegyzet kódokkal
- Hasznos tutorial itt, itt és itt.
- 3. óra (feb. 26.): Verziókövetés: párhuzamos ágak és azok egybefűzése - gyakorlat [Ricsi]
- Sematikus jegyzet kódokkal
- Hasznos tutorial itt.
- 4. óra (márc. 4.): Build rendszerek bevezetés - elmélet [Balázs]
- Sematikus jegyzet kódokkal
- Órai diasor itt (18-56 diák).
- 5. óra (márc. 11.): Root alapok - elmélet [Balázs]
- Sematikus jegyzet kódokkal
- Órán vetített diasor (TBA).
- Előrehozott tavaszi szünet(márc. 18.)
- 6. óra (márc. 25.): Weblapszerkesztés I.: Github domain és HTML bevezető CSS-sel - gyakorlat [Furu]
- Sematikus jegyzet kódokkal
- Maga az óra itt érhető el. Az elkészített honlap itt.
- 7. óra (ápr. 1.): Weblapszerkesztés II.: Még több CSS, Jupyter Slideshow - gyakorlat [Furu]
- Sematikus jegyzet kódokkal
- Maga az óra itt érhető el. Az elkészült weblapot és slideshowkat az előző óra linkjén éritek el.
- 8. óra (ápr. 8.): Tesztelés [Ricsi]
- Óra teamsen
- 9. óra (ápr. 15.): Tesztelés [Ricsi]
- Óra teamsen
- 10. óra (ápr. 22.): Tesztelés [Ricsi]
- Óra teamsen
- 11. óra (ápr. 29.): Jira, Confluence, Bitbucket [Ricsi]
- Óra teamsen
- 5. óra (márc. 11.): Build rendszerek bevezetés - gyakorlat [Balázs]
- 6. óra (márc. 18.): Weblapszerkesztés I.: Github domain és HTML bevezető CSS-sel - gyakorlat [Furu]
- 7. óra (márc. 25.): Weblapszerkesztés II.: Még több CSS, Javascript alapok - gyakorlat [Furu]
- 8. óra (ápr. 1.): Weblapszerkesztés vége, Python prezentáció: JQuery, Jupyter slideshow - gyakorlat [Furu]
- X. óra: (TBA)
- Bevezetés
- Basic HTML webpage
- Basic CSS
- Basic Javascript
- Basic Ipyhton Slideshow
Go to back. Go to top. Go to home.